Turning Houses into Havens: Small Touches That Make a Big Difference

A house is more than just a structure; it's a canvas waiting to be filled with the colors of comfort, warmth, and personality. Transforming a house into a haven doesn't always require a major renovation or a hefty budget. Sometimes, it's the small touches that make the biggest impact. In this blog post, we'll explore some simple yet effective ways to turn your house into a welcoming sanctuary.

1. Personalized Welcome: The moment someone steps through your front door, they should feel instantly welcomed. A personalized touch, such as a cheerful doormat with your family name or a charming welcome sign, sets the tone for what lies ahead. It's a small gesture that speaks volumes about the warmth and hospitality of your home.

2. Soft Lighting and Ambiance: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ood and ambiance of a space. Opt for soft, warm lighting rather than harsh overhead lights. Add table lamps, floor lamps, and string lights to create cozy nooks and inviting corners. Consider incorporating candles or flameless LED candles for an extra touch of warmth and intimacy, especially during evenings or special occasions.

3. Greenery and Natural Elements: Bringing the outdoors in can instantly breathe life into a space. Place potted plants or fresh flowers throughout your home to add a pop of color and freshness. Not only do plants purify the air, but they also have a calming effect, creating a sense of tranquility and connection to nature. Additionally, incorporating natural materials such as wood, stone, and woven textures adds depth and warmth to your decor.

4. Thoughtful Details: It's often the little details that make a house feel like a home. Display cherished photographs in beautiful frames, hang meaningful artwork, or showcase sentimental keepsakes that tell the story of your life and experiences. Invest in quality bedding and plush throw blankets for an extra layer of comfort and luxury. Consider adding a cozy reading nook with a comfortable armchair, soft cushions, and a selection of your favorite books.

5. Scents That Soothe: Scent has a powerful influence on our mood and emotions. Infuse your home with inviting fragrances that evoke feelings of comfort and relaxation. Whether it's through scented candles, essential oil diffusers, or fresh baking in the kitchen, choose scents that resonate with you and create a sense of homecoming every time you walk through the door.
